          @дима-мельниченко I know it works with walking, but it is a metric developed for running and cycling. It’s also not a direct measurement but just a guess based on the proxy of effort against output. The faster you can run with the lowest HR, the higher Firstbeat VO2max will be. Contrary, the slower you go with the highest HR, the lower it will go.

                  @tobi74 it’s not due to the new update. Right ? You had done a full reset of the watch correct ?

                  Although it’s covered here , vo2max is determined by firstbeat and that is a black box for suunto.

                  What helps is to have a good hr reading , run in zone 3 and higher , for more than 15 minutes , and I would say about ,30mins + for the whole run.

                  If you use ohr , it can be more tricky as if the ohr quality is not good enough, it won’t report vo2 max.

                  If you use a belt, clean it up to not have artifacts.

                  The only reason that vo2max is not appearing is due to the black box from firstbeat not being able to get a good quality run to determine that. And that applies only for the first time it needs to determine the base.

                  If the first run cannot determine a vo2max then the last 6 runs / walks start to contribute to a more generic detection.

                      @tobi74 soft resets are no issue, but every time you do a hard reset it starts from scratch and it may take a while to estimate the value again. So hard resets aren’t a way to make VO2max reappear faster, they are a way to postpone it further.
